From the moment I was transferred to Haley’s ward, after two days in the ICU, it was immediately clear that she is an exceptional nurse. Upon our first meeting, Haley demonstrated a rare ability to listen deeply and respond with insight and precision. She instinctively understood not just my immediate medical needs, but also the emotional complexities I was facing. Haley’s professional knowledge and skill never wavered—she anticipated what I required, often before I could fully articulate it myself, and addressed my concerns with compassion and expertise.
As someone with a science background, I particularly appreciated that Haley engaged me on a level that respected my knowledge and never oversimplified my care. She explained my condition and the interventions with clarity and honesty, fostering trust and encouraging my involvement in the care process. When I experienced unexplained abdominal pain, Haley responded promptly and thoughtfully—contacting doctors to consider necessary scans and adjusting medications. It was clear I was suffering from intense gas pains associated with a distended colon. The medicines helped, and she never made me feel as though my concerns were burdensome or unfounded.
Haley’s care extended beyond my physical recovery and touched my family as well. My daughter, K, has struggled with anorexia in the past and was deeply affected by seeing me, her mother, in a weakened state after significant weight loss during my hospitalization and preceding problems with nausea. This was a highly emotional and sensitive topic for both of us. During a particularly difficult conversation, K said she wanted to talk to a doctor or nurse in an effort to have them convince me I can let myself go, and that that would be ok. But it is not ok with me. I have always had a BMI in the healthy range. She asked Haley, who responded with remarkable empathy and wisdom, speaking to my daughter in a soft, calming manner and gently reminding her that everyone’s health journey is unique, and what is right for one person may not be right for another. Haley’s words brought comfort and understanding in a moment of distress, opening a much-needed dialogue between my daughter and me that we had never managed before. This is all thanks to Haley, who somehow was able to broach a taboo topic that has now allowed K and me to better understand each other.
Haley’s approach to care is, in a word, transformative. She embodies the very spirit of nursing—combining professional excellence with extraordinary kindness and intuition. Her dedication not only met my physical needs but also addressed the emotional well-being of both myself and my daughter during a vulnerable and challenging time.
I am profoundly grateful for Haley’s presence, expertise, and compassion. I sincerely hope she receives the recognition she so greatly deserves.
